Fishing pond solar photovoltaic power generation piling
"Fishery- photovoltaic complementation" refers to the combination of aquaculture and photovoltaic power generation. It involves installing a photovoltaic panel array above the water surface of fish ponds, while allowing fish and shrimp farming in the water below. The electricity generated by the photovoltaic panels can supply power to the entire fish pond, or it can be sent to the substation. . Is solar photovoltaic power generation cost-effective
In 2024, solar photovoltaics (PV) were, on average, 41% cheaper than the lowest-cost fossil fuel alternatives, while onshore wind projects were 53% cheaper.
